Tsunoda to stay at AlphaTauri for F1 2023 season
Formula One's Faenza based outfit AlphaTauri have confirmed that Yuki Tsunoda will stay with the team for the 2023 F1 season, following his first successful two years with the Italian team. The Japanese driver made his debut with the Faenza based outfit in 2021, and has completed 36 races since. He scored two points at his first ever F1 race in Bahrain last year, collecting a total of 32 points on his way to 14th place in the Drivers’ Standings. However, his second season has been more difficult so far as he has only scored points on three occasions with Round 6 of the 2022 F1 season, the Spanish Grand Prix being the last time that he finished in the top ten.
